Edifier R1080BT Bookshelf Bluetooth Speaker
The Edifier R1080BT Active 2.0 Bluetooth Bookshelf Speaker features Silk-dome tweeters that provide a more balanced, realistic tone to the music you enjoy, providing a warmer, more polished sound. Turn up the volume and hear audio that remains smooth and precise even in noisy environments. The 1080BT's pleasant tone is complemented by rich, powerful lows and a balanced midrange. Experience a powerful bottom end that compliments rather than overpowers your mids and highs. A matte finish offers a timeless look, while a smooth front panel creates a luxurious feel that you'll enjoy admiring for years to come. This Edifier R1080BT Active 2.0 Bluetooth Bookshelf Speaker Modern Digital Signal Processing (DSP) allows the unit to playback sound with greater precision than analog signals alone can muster. A thick MDF wooden enclosure keeps the cabinet from vibrating too much, which creates a smoother, clearer sound. Bluetooth, AUX and PC inputs are available for both lossy and lossless playback. An easy-to-reach set of buttons on the top and back panel of the unit allow you to easily adjust playback on the fly. A bass reflex port allows air to circulate more freely, improving its efficiency. That means you get a lower cut-off frequency on the low pass filter, which greatly improves sound response; plus, you get reduced distortion because the port is doing a lot of the work, which reduces the amount of cabinet resonance.
